From 915a3d45609ff0f80efef326346affab262a973e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Simo=20F=C3=A4lt?= Date: Mon, 19 Feb 2024 11:28:39 +0200 Subject: [PATCH] COIN: Move skipping Debian instructions to qt5 repo Task-number: QTBUG-122447 Change-Id: I385d60d891c68edc3aa053d3561335a46b26923b Reviewed-by: Toni Saario (cherry picked from commit df1efc70b0cb3eeff4c59adbf58702af1d9a9200) Reviewed-by: Qt Cherry-pick Bot (cherry picked from commit 233ce5b018a5bca2b9a0c54a57707edcfa14c04e) --- .../debian/prepare_debian_env.yaml | 18 ++++-------------- 1 file changed, 4 insertions(+), 14 deletions(-) diff --git a/coin/instructions/debian/prepare_debian_env.yaml b/coin/instructions/debian/prepare_debian_env.yaml index fd130cebc72..4c004adaa58 100644 --- a/coin/instructions/debian/prepare_debian_env.yaml +++ b/coin/instructions/debian/prepare_debian_env.yaml @@ -47,20 +47,10 @@ instructions: variableName: COIN_SKIP_DEBIAN variableValue: "MISSING_DEBIAN_INST" enable_if: - condition: or - conditions: - - condition: runtime - env_var: TESTED_MODULE_COIN - equals_value: "qtactiveqt" - - condition: runtime - env_var: TESTED_MODULE_COIN - equals_value: "qtqa" - - condition: runtime - env_var: TESTED_MODULE_COIN - equals_value: "qtdoc" - - condition: runtime - env_var: TESTED_MODULE_COIN - equals_value: "qt5" + condition: runtime + env_var: COIN_SKIP_DEBIAN_MODULES + contains_value: "{{.Env.TESTED_MODULE_COIN}}" + # Set version info to environment - type: ParseEnvironmentVariableFromFile regex: "QT_REPO_MODULE_VERSION \"(?P.*)\""